Flaws in the iVote internet and telephone voting system used in the 2019 New South Wales election could have made it vulnerable to undetectable voter fraud, a new report has revealed.

The report by Melbourne School of Engineering Vanessa Teague has shown how the iVote system suffers from an error in its verification process that could allow the verification of votes to be “tricked”, meaning some valid votes could be converted into invalid ones, and not counted.
